Concrete footing repair services focus on restoring the stability and integrity of the foundational supports that hold up structures such as homes, garages, and commercial buildings. These services typically involve assessing the existing footings, removing damaged or compromised sections, and replacing or reinforcing them to ensure they can properly bear the weight of the building. Proper footing repair helps prevent further structural issues by addressing problems at the foundation level, which is critical for maintaining the safety and longevity of a property.
Problems that lead to footing repairs often include shifting or settling of the soil, water erosion, or age-related deterioration of the concrete. Common signs indicating a need for footing repair include uneven floors, cracks in walls or the foundation, sticking doors or windows, and visible settling of the structure. Addressing these issues early with professional footing repair can help avoid more extensive and costly repairs down the line, preserving the property's value and safety.

The overview below groups typical Concrete Footing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Grand Junction, CO.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typically, minor concrete footing repairs in Grand Junction, CO, cost between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, especially for cracks or small sections needing stabilization. Larger or more complex repairs may cost more depending on the extent of damage.
Moderate Fixes - Mid-sized projects, such as replacing or reinforcing larger footing sections, usually range from $600 to $1,500. These are common for homeowners addressing significant settling or shifting issues with their foundations.
Major Repairs - Extensive repairs involving significant footing reconstruction or underpinning can range from $1,500 to $3,500. While less frequent, these projects often require more labor and materials, impacting overall costs.
Full Replacement - Complete footing replacement or foundation overhaul can exceed $5,000, especially for larger properties or complex situations. Such projects are less common but are necessary for severe structural issues requiring comprehensive work by local contractors.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are concrete footings and why are they important? Concrete footings provide a stable base for structures like walls and foundations, helping prevent settling and shifting that can cause damage over time.
How can I tell if my concrete footings need repair? Signs include visible cracks, uneven settling, or doors and windows that no longer operate properly, indicating possible footing issues.
What types of repairs do local contractors typically perform for concrete footings? Repairs may involve underpinning, reinforcing existing footings, or installing new footings to restore stability and support.
Are there different methods for repairing damaged concrete footings? Yes, options include epoxy injections, underpinning, or replacing sections of the footing, depending on the extent of damage.
